Council discusses mask mandate

For now the Lake City City Council has adopted a wait-and-see approach to a potential ordinance mandating masks in some public spaces.

At the July 13 council meeting, Mayor Mark Nichols said he has heard from advocates of a mask requirement and asked fellow councilmembers to weigh in.

The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ention recommend wearing masks in grocery stores and other public places where it’s difficult to maintain a social distance of at least six feet.
